Tower Hamlets GoodGym visited Stepney City Farm for the second time in three days. Today, in bright sunlight, we joined other keen helpers for the latest in the farm's volunteering events,

Heather and John swept up leaves and straw, while Gemma and Nina moved a mountain of compost, armed only with very sharp forks. Gemma was in some pain after hearing that West Ham United were losing to Kidderminster Harriers.

Afterwards, we went on a tour of the farm, which now includes two body-crawling ferrets.

Stepney City Farm is a three acre working farm - a rural oasis - in the heart of Tower Hamlets.

Stepney City Farm is an educational charity aiming to improve lives through farming. The farm provides a welcoming place to bring together a diverse community, and cultivate wellbeing through high-welfare, environmentally-sustainable farming practices.
